Given below are two statements.
Assertion (A):
If \(A\) and \(B\) are two Boolean terms, then \(A+AB=A\).
Reason (R):
\(x+xy=x\) is absorption law in Boolean Algebra.

Show Hint

Absorption laws are \(A+AB=A\) and \(A(A+B)=A\).
